Owner report 10104937 · 2005-01-02 (January 2, 2005)
PREMATURE WEAR ON ALL FOUR BRAKE ROTORS FOR THIS TRUCK. ROTORS COULD NOT BE TURNED ON FIRST BRAKE PAD CHANGE BECAUSE THEY WERE RUSTING FROM THE INSIDE OUT. THE METAL USED TO MANUFACTURE THESE ROTORS HAD TO BE OF INFERIOR QUALITY. BRAKE PADS WERE STILL FAIRLY GOOD ! *JB
Owner-reported narrative. 7,900 miles reported. Look up ODI 10104937 at NHTSA ↗
Owner report 10134357 · 2005-08-26 (August 26, 2005)
THE ABS BRAKE SYSTEM FAILS AT SLOW SPEEDS MAKING IT ALMOST IMPOSSIBLE TO STOP THE VEHICLE. THE FIRST TIME IT HAPPENED I NEARLY ENTERED A BUSY HIGHWAY AS I WAS UNABLE TO STOP PROMPTLY. AFTER A FEW DAYS IT HAPPENED AGAIN AND I NEARLY HIT A BUILDING AS I WAS TRYING TO STOP IN A PARKING SPACE. IT WAS OBVIOUS THAT THIS WAS A SAFETY PROBLEM. HOWEVER THE AUTHORIZED REPAIR FACILITY WOULD NOT MAKE THE NECESSARY REPAIRS UNLESS I PAID THE BILL. THEY HAD TO CLEAN THE ABS SENSORS TO CORRECT THIS PROBLEM. *JB
Owner-reported narrative. 43,500 miles reported. Look up ODI 10134357 at NHTSA ↗

Owner report 10204571 · 2007-10-01 (October 1, 2007)
I RELIED ON THE PARKING BRAKE WHILE I WAS DOING SOME WORK. THE PARKING BRAKE FAILED TO HOLD, AND THE VEHICLE ROLLED. LUCKILY I NEARLY AVOIDED BEING STRUCK. FURTHER ANALYSIS SHOWS THAT THIS IS A PROBLEM ON ALL CHEVY AND GM PICKUP TRUCKS FOR 2002. THERE WAS A RECALL FOR THE VEHICLES WITH MANUAL TRANSMISSIONS, BUT NOT THOSE WITH A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SIONS. THE VEHICLES WITH AUTOMATIC TRANSMISSIONS HAVE THE EXACT SAME PROBLEM, BUT THE TRANSMISSION MUST BE RELIED ON TO HOLD THE VEHICLE. THE MANUFACTURER REFUSES PROVIDE THE UPGRADED PARKING BRAKE…
Owner-reported narrative. 12,000 miles reported. Look up ODI 10204571 at NHTSA ↗
